Toys & Chews.
While the majority of kennels and daycares will certainly have toys offered for your pet, it's always a great concept to bring your own. Try to find toys that are durable and made of safe materials. Also, select eat toys that are appropriate for your pet dog's dimension, age and chewing practices. As an example, if your pet is a compulsive chewer, stay clear of plastic toys that can splinter. Instead, attempt Kong-type playthings that can be stuffed with peanut butter, cheese or treats.
Likewise, pick long-lasting chews like rawhide or dental chews (such as Virbac C.E.T Chemical Health Chews). These help eliminate plaque and tartar from your family pet's teeth as they eat. The chews should be little sufficient to not posture a risk of choking or digestive tract blockages, and need to be easy for your animal to absorb.
Food & Treats.
Equally as moms and dads wouldn't send their children to institution without a lunch and publication bag, pets should be prepared to go to day care with the ideal products. This consists of any dog boarding facility near me food or treats your canine may require throughout their keep (if they adhere to a special diet) and medication, if needed.
Bear in mind that high-value deals with need to be fed moderately and accounted for in your animal's everyday calories. A few of their preferred playthings or packed pets can be soothing and aid with the change to a brand-new environment.
Be sure to bring your dog's regular food, as abrupt changes in diet plan can result in upset stomachs, gas and diarrhea. Identifying your pet dog's dishes in different plastic bags can make feeding times much easier for team and additionally make certain that your dog obtains the proper quantity of food daily.
